Project Argentina
7 DAYS
Buenos Aires, Volunteer Project
|
Buenos Aires,
Volunteer project
Spend 5
days volunteering alongside a group of Argentinian youth being
taught essential life skills in a loving and idyllic subsistence
farm environment. Well-known chefs from Buenos Aires visit the farm
to teach the kids menu planning, food preparation and cooking
skills. Help out on the organic farm and in the restaurant, with
time to relax.

Project Cuzco Kids
14 DAYS
Cuzco, Volunteer with Children, Cuzco, Volunteer with Children, Cuzco |
Volunteering at a drop in
centre for children, participating in workshops like leather working
and jewelry making, exploring the cultures and history of Cuzco.
Spend two weeks
volunteering at a drop-in center for children alongside staff and
other international volunteers. Play games, help with homework,
teach English, help with the cooking, and participate in various
workshops such as leather working and jewelry making.
